How Is The Real Estate Market in Belwood of Los Gatos, Belgatos, and Surmont (in east Los Gatos)?
The Los Gatos real estate market has fared better than many other parts of Silicon Valley in recent months, but prices are declining, days on the market area increasing and inventory is climing.
The median sales (sold) price of homes is down about 26% year over year in Los Gatos (95030 and 95032). List prices appear to be flat (see graph below, which is from Altos Research, a subscription I have) but in many price points, homes are being reduced multiple times prior to selling.

The Fantasy of Lights festival at Vasona Lake County Park
When: The Fantasy of Lights begins Nov. 27 & continues through Dec. 31, 2009, 6 - 10pm nightly.
Where: Vasona Lake County Park, 333 Blossom Hill Rd. (adjacent to Oak Meadow Park, which is at the corner of Blossom Hill Road and University Avenue), Los Gatos
How much: The cost varies. For lowest pricing, go early in the season! Discount price of $10 per car up to December 10th. $15 from 12/11 - 12/31. For vehicles. with 10-15 passengers, admission is $25. It is $50 for (commercial) busses.
